Saeujeot
Quite a few samples of fermented foods include things like Saeujeot (Korean salted fermented shrimp), kimchi (Korean fermented cabbage), and Dongbaekha (white shrimp harvested in February and April). These foods are popular in Korea, where These are accustomed to flavor soups and steamed eggs. Nonetheless, the quality of these foods is determined by the kind of shrimp harvested And exactly how clean They're.
A analyze was executed to find out the results of different salt concentrations on saeujeot fermentation. Four sets of samples were geared up with unique salt concentrations and ended up incubated at 15degC for 142 times. Amino acid and metabolite concentrations were being determined. Additionally, the bacterial community was examined to find out the influence of different salt concentrations on the bacterial successions.
The bacterial Local community adjusted through the fermentation period of time, with probably the most rapid modifications taking place through the early levels. The bacterial abundances ended up believed employing qPCR, and also the bacterial 16S rRNA gene copy figures enhanced during the early stages of fermentation. The bacterial 16S rRNA gene duplicate selection greater from one.3x10 8 copies/ml to 8.8x10 nine copies/ml. The bacterial proteinase action was weak in samples that were exposed to large salt concentrations.
The bacterial metabolite concentrations were being comparable to People present in samples which were not exposed to substantial salt concentrations. Acetate, TMAO, and lactate were recognized as the main organic compounds. Even so, these compounds were not located in all samples.
Archaea, Proteobacteria, and Firmicutes dominated during the Original stage with the fermentation, though the Proteobacteria remained dominant through the progressing stages. The presence of Archaea could reveal that these groups contributed additional to jeotgal fermentation less than high salt conditions compared to bacterial customers.
